Quoting: earl08
hmm, I think they aren't sure about Meyers (poor play) or Helm (injury). Even with Meyers healthy, he's bounced to the AHL a bit and Avs have played with 11 F. Eller would be 4C

How was Eller been? I've heard he really slowed down.


It's been a struggle the last 1&1/2 to 2 years for Eller. He's been completely invisible at 5v5, has seen a drop in play on PK (not a horrible drop, he's still effective but a drop none the less), and his best asset right now is his faceoffs. I think he has potential to be better in Colorado's system but I don't know if I'd be confident in a return to 2018 form.
